Cost

doorpanels-300x200.jpgupvc double glazed sash windows (https://mexiconoise0.werite.net) are a stylish and durable choice for your home. They can also be extremely economical. They are extremely energy efficient and can cut down your heating bills by as much as 40 percent. Furthermore they are made of a hard-wearing material that will not be able to swell or discolor. These advantages make uPVC windows a great long-term investment for your home.

The initial installation cost of uPVC Sash windows can range from PS450 to PS1,200, depending on the size and customisation options. This investment will pay for itself in the long run with lower energy and maintenance costs. UPVC sash windows are more attractive and add value to a home than traditional timber sash window.

Maintenance

uPVC double glazed sash windows are an excellent option for older homes as they resemble traditional timber window frames. They are also sturdy, long-lasting and easy to maintain. To keep them looking great regular cleaning with soapy water is all that's required. It is important to check and lubricate all the mechanisms.

One of the biggest benefits of uPVC sash windows is that they don't need to be painted, which will save time and cost. There are many colours, finishes, and sizes to pick from and you'll be able to find the perfect design for your home. Sliding uPVC sash windows can be also very secure. They come with a variety of locking mechanisms, and can be upgraded for the most secure home security.

uPVC is also extremely robust and weatherproof. This means that your windows will not fade or crack over time, meaning they'll remain beautiful for years to come. They are also less difficult to clean than wooden windows. You can use a damp cloth to wipe down the frame, but don't scratch the frame as it could damage it.

The best method to clean uPVC is to make use of a soft cloth that has been soaked in mild detergent and warm water. Rinse the frames and dry them rapidly to prevent streaks. It is also advisable to clean the sill in case you have a large or wide window. Be sure that there isn't any dirt or dust is getting into the space between your window and the floor.

The putty or beading used to seal the joints of sash windows could begin to fail. This can cause the sound of a whistling or draught. It's important to have this fixed as soon as you notice it.

Fortunately, this is an easy repair job that can be done by your local uPVC installer. The draught can be repaired by using a small amount of expanding foam and the beading or putty can be replaced with the sash window sealant to ensure that your uPVC windows will remain in good condition for a long time to come.
